    Have you tried the fronts TB?

    I did about 60kms yesterday with Axel and Grant and we done some fairly snotty rocky sections and the rear Scorpion perform quiet well. Hooked up when needed. I did find on the hard packed sandy trails it seemed a little slipery, a bit more than the Dunlop I usually use.

    But I will go another Scorpion on the back as it looks to keep it’s ‘edge’ better than the Dunlop.
